Ingredients: The Essential Trio
While you can certainly get creative with additions, the foundation of this dish rests on three high-impact ingredients. (Note: You will also need a base of pre-made pizza dough or crescent roll dough).
- 1 cup Pizza Sauce or Marinara: Choose a thick, herb-heavy sauce to prevent the rollups from becoming too “wet.”
- 1 1/2 cups Shredded Mozzarella Cheese: Provides the classic “cheese pull” and balances the salt of the pepperoni.
- 20–25 slices Pepperoni: Standard or “cup and char” varieties work best for maximum flavor.
- 1 tube Pizza Dough (refrigerated): The structural vessel for your rollups.
- Optional: 1 tbsp Melted Butter and 1/2 tsp Garlic Powder for the crust.
